Diagnosis
A diagnosis of ADHD is the first step to receiving the help you require. If you're looking to get disability benefits or reasonable adjustments in your work or school An ADHD assessment can help. You can request a referral from your GP, or pay for an independent specialist. Research before deciding on an independent service. You can learn about local services by word-of-mouth or by reading online reviews. The cost of a private diagnosis could vary from PS500 to PS1,200 in London. In addition to an ADHD evaluation, a private psychiatrist will usually screen for and treat co-morbidities like depression or anxiety.
Unfortunately, the NHS is struggling to cope with the demand for adult ADHD assessments for adults with ADHD. Many GPs are reluctant to refer patients because they do not have the necessary knowledge or training. Others are overwhelmed by the volume of people requesting diagnosis, which is growing quickly as the general public becomes more aware of ADHD and neurodiversity. As a result, some are using short cuts to get an ADHD diagnosis, as demonstrated by the Panorama programme.
Ask your GP why they refuse to refer you for medical examination. If they say it is because of funding concerns it's worth looking for a new GP - particularly if you intend to pursue a Shared Care Agreement for medications down the line. Psychiatry UK provides excellent tips on how do i get diagnosed with adhd to do this, with templates for letters and forms.
Choose your private ADHD assessment provider with care after you have received a referral. It is important to ensure that they are members of the General Medical Council, and the specialist registrar they employ has been trained in adult ADHD. The service must follow the NICE guidelines on adult ADHD assessments.
You will receive a report as well as a plan of action from your doctor following the evaluation. This will include a discussion of the possibility of treating with stimulants, if appropriate. You may be contacted by an occupational or clinical psychologist therapy therapist to attend regular sessions.

Medication
A private ADHD assessment allows you to get a diagnosis from an expert and receive treatment. The process is generally extensive and involves a lengthy consultation with a psychiatrist and often the need to bring reports from school. The psychiatrist will also need to determine if your symptoms are present since the time you were a child. This can be a challenge for older adults who do not have access to their old school records. The psychiatric doctor will also examine any family history of mental health issues and search for any co-morbidities, like anxiety or depression which are common in ADHD.
Private providers can provide ADHD assessments via Skype or over the phone. This is a good option for those living far from the most effective clinics in the UK. This type of assessment is less expensive than an NHS Maudsley referral and it can be much quicker. It is important to understand that a private examination does not mean that medication will be prescribed. Many doctors are reluctant to sign a "shared care agreement" with a patient that has been diagnosed privately. This is especially true if the medication dosage has not been properly titrated.

It could take an extended time to receive an ADHD diagnosis. You will have to see a psychiatrist and undergo a thorough evaluation. The psychiatrist will examine your current problems and the ones you experienced in your childhood. He or she may also request evidence, such as old school reports. The psychiatrist will determine if your ADHD symptoms cause significant impairment. The psychiatrist will also assess your co-morbidity. This includes any other mental disorders.
The diagnosis can take about 2 hours minimum. Your doctor will evaluate you for each of the three main traits of ADHD such as hyperactivity, inattention and impulsivity. The psychiatrist will then make use of these tests to determine if you are a candidate for ADHD. Some people with ADHD possess all three traits, while others have multiple symptoms.
